"""Hides imports and other irrelevant things so that ipython works nicely."""
|
||||
|
||||
from pydub import AudioSegment
|
||||
import StringIO
|
||||
import _rpitx
|
||||
import array
|
||||
import logging
|
||||
import wave
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def broadcast_fm(file_, frequency):
|
||||
"""Play a music file over FM."""
|
||||
|
||||
logging.basicConfig()
|
||||
logger = logging.getLogger('rpitx')
|
||||
|
||||
def _reencode(file_name):
|
||||
"""Returns an AudioSegment file reencoded to the proper WAV format."""
|
||||
original = AudioSegment.from_file(file_name)
|
||||
if original.channels > 2:
|
||||
raise ValueError('Too many channels in sound file')
|
||||
if original.channels == 2:
|
||||
# TODO: Support stereo. For now, just overlay into mono.
|
||||
logger.info('Reducing stereo channels to mono')
|
||||
left, right = original.split_to_mono()
|
||||
original = left.overlay(right)
|
||||
|
||||
return original
|
||||
|
||||
raw_audio_data = _reencode(file_)
|
||||
|
||||
wav_data = StringIO.StringIO()
|
||||
wav_writer = wave.open(wav_data, 'w')
|
||||
wav_writer.setnchannels(1)
|
||||
wav_writer.setsampwidth(2)
|
||||
wav_writer.setframerate(48000)
|
||||
wav_writer.writeframes(raw_audio_data.raw_data)
|
||||
wav_writer.close()
|
||||
|
||||
raw_array = array.array('c')
|
||||
raw_array.fromstring(wav_data.getvalue())
|
||||
array_address, length = raw_array.buffer_info()
|
||||
_rpitx.broadcast_fm(array_address, length, frequency)
